"เชิงเส้น" หมายถึงอะไรในบริบทของคอมพิวเตอร์และเทคโนโลยี
ในบริบทของคอมพิวเตอร์และเทคโนโลยี โดยทั่วไป "เชิงเส้น" หมายถึงความก้าวหน้าตามลำดับหรือทีละขั้นตอน โดยที่งานหรือการดำเนินการเกิดขึ้นตามลำดับที่ตรงไปตรงมาและคาดเดาได้ มันแตกต่างกับแนวทางที่ไม่เป็นเชิงเส้นที่เกี่ยวข้องกับโครงสร้างที่ซับซ้อน แตกแขนง หรือขนานกันมากขึ้น กระบวนการเชิงเส้นมักมีลักษณะเฉพาะด้วยการไหลของการปฏิบัติงานที่ชัดเจนและเป็นระเบียบโดยไม่มีการเบี่ยงเบนอย่างมีนัยสำคัญ
เหตุใดอัลกอริธึมการค้นหาเชิงเส้นจึงมักใช้ในการเขียนโปรแกรม
อัลกอริธึมการค้นหาเชิงเส้นมักใช้ในการเขียนโปรแกรมเนื่องจากง่ายและใช้งานง่าย มันเกี่ยวข้องกับการตรวจสอบแต่ละองค์ประกอบในรายการหรืออาร์เรย์ตามลำดับจนกว่าจะพบรายการที่ตรงกันหรือถึงจุดสิ้นสุดของรายการ แม้ว่ามันอาจจะไม่ใช่อัลกอริธึมการค้นหาที่มีประสิทธิภาพมากที่สุดสำหรับชุดข้อมูลขนาดใหญ่ แต่ก็ทำงานได้ดีสำหรับการรวบรวมข้อมูลขนาดเล็กถึงขนาดกลาง
การถดถอยเชิงเส้นทำงานอย่างไรในการวิเคราะห์ข้อมูล
การถดถอยเชิงเส้นเป็นเทคนิคทางสถิติที่ใช้ในการวิเคราะห์ข้อมูลเพื่อสร้างแบบจำลองความสัมพันธ์ระหว่างตัวแปรสองตัว โดยถือว่าความสัมพันธ์เชิงเส้นระหว่างตัวแปรอิสระ (อินพุต) และตัวแปรตาม (เอาต์พุต) เป้าหมายคือการค้นหาเส้นตรงที่เหมาะสมที่สุดที่จะลดผลรวมของความแตกต่างกำลังสองระหว่างค่าที่สังเกตและค่าที่คาดการณ์ไว้ให้เหลือน้อยที่สุด เส้นนี้สามารถใช้เพื่อคาดการณ์หรือสรุปเกี่ยวกับข้อมูลได้
การเขียนโปรแกรมเชิงเส้นหมายความว่าอย่างไร
การโปรแกรมเชิงเส้นเป็นเทคนิคการหาค่าเหมาะที่สุดทางคณิตศาสตร์ที่ใช้ในการแก้ปัญหาข้อจำกัดเชิงเส้น มันเกี่ยวข้องกับการขยายหรือย่อฟังก์ชันวัตถุประสงค์ให้เหลือน้อยที่สุด ในขณะเดียวกันก็ตอบสนองชุดของความเท่าเทียมกันเชิงเส้นหรือข้อจำกัดของอสมการ มีการใช้งานที่หลากหลายในด้านต่างๆ เช่น การจัดสรรทรัพยากร การวางแผนการผลิต การขนส่ง และการกำหนดเวลา
ข้อดีของการสื่อสารเชิงเส้นคืออะไร?
การสื่อสารเชิงเส้นหรือที่เรียกว่าการสื่อสารทางเดียว มีข้อดีในบางสถานการณ์ ช่วยให้การไหลของข้อมูลที่ชัดเจนและรัดกุมจากผู้ส่งไปยังผู้รับโดยไม่มีการหยุดชะงักหรือข้อเสนอแนะ มีประโยชน์อย่างยิ่งในการถ่ายทอดคำสั่ง ประกาศ หรือนำเสนอโดยเน้นไปที่การส่งข้อมูลมากกว่าการมีส่วนร่วมในการสนทนา
พีชคณิตเชิงเส้นมีบทบาทในการเรียนรู้ของเครื่องหรือไม่?
ใช่แล้ว พีชคณิตเชิงเส้นมีบทบาทสำคัญในการเรียนรู้ของเครื่อง เป็นรากฐานทางคณิตศาสตร์สำหรับแนวคิดและอัลกอริทึมต่างๆ ที่ใช้ในสาขานี้ การแปลงเชิงเส้น ปริภูมิเวกเตอร์ เมทริกซ์ และค่าลักษณะเฉพาะเป็นตัวอย่างของแนวคิดพีชคณิตเชิงเส้นที่พบการใช้งานในพื้นที่ต่างๆ เช่น การประมวลผลข้อมูลล่วงหน้า การลดขนาดมิติ การถดถอย และอัลกอริธึมการจำแนกประเภท
การเขียนโค้ดเชิงเส้นมีส่วนช่วยในการตรวจจับและแก้ไขข้อผิดพลาดอย่างไร
เทคนิคการเข้ารหัสเชิงเส้น เช่น รหัสบล็อกเชิงเส้นหรือรหัสวงจร ใช้ในการตรวจจับและแก้ไขข้อผิดพลาด ด้วยการแนะนำบิตที่ซ้ำซ้อนในข้อมูลที่ส่ง รหัสเหล่านี้จึงสามารถตรวจจับและแก้ไขข้อผิดพลาดที่เกิดขึ้นระหว่างการส่งข้อมูลได้ ทำงานโดยการเพิ่มข้อมูลพาริตีหรือใช้รหัสแก้ไขข้อผิดพลาด เช่น รหัส Hamming เพื่อให้มั่นใจในความสมบูรณ์ของข้อมูล และลดผลกระทบจากข้อผิดพลาดในการส่ง
ความสามารถในการปรับขนาดเชิงเส้นในการคำนวณคืออะไร?
ความสามารถในการปรับขนาดเชิงเส้นหมายถึงความสามารถของระบบหรือแอปพลิเคชันในการจัดการกับปริมาณงานหรือความต้องการที่เพิ่มขึ้นโดยการเพิ่มทรัพยากรในลักษณะเชิงเส้นหรือตามสัดส่วน กล่าวอีกนัยหนึ่ง เมื่อปริมาณงานหรือจำนวนผู้ใช้เพิ่มขึ้น ประสิทธิภาพของระบบจะปรับขนาดเป็นเส้นตรงโดยไม่มีปัญหาคอขวดหรือการเสื่อมลงอย่างมีนัยสำคัญ ความสามารถในการปรับขนาดเชิงเส้นเป็นคุณลักษณะที่ต้องการสำหรับระบบแบบกระจาย การประมวลผลแบบคลาวด์ และแอปพลิเคชันที่สามารถปรับขนาดได้สูง
ความซับซ้อนของเวลาเชิงเส้นมีบทบาทอย่างไรในการวิเคราะห์อัลกอริทึม
ความซับซ้อนของเวลาเชิงเส้น ซึ่งมักแสดงเป็น O(n) อธิบายอัลกอริทึมที่เวลาในการดำเนินการจะเพิ่มขึ้นเป็นเส้นตรงตามขนาดของข้อมูลอินพุต หมายความว่าเวลาที่ใช้ในการดำเนินการอัลกอริทึมนั้นแปรผันโดยตรงกับจำนวนองค์ประกอบที่กำลังประมวลผล การวิเคราะห์ความซับซ้อนของเวลาของอัลกอริธึมช่วยในการทำความเข้าใจประสิทธิภาพและคาดการณ์ว่าอัลกอริธึมจะดำเนินการอย่างไรเมื่อขนาดอินพุตเพิ่มขึ้น
โพลาไรเซชันเชิงเส้นมีการใช้งานใด ๆ ในโทรคมนาคมหรือไม่?
ใช่ โพลาไรเซชันเชิงเส้นพบการใช้งานที่หลากหลายในโทรคมนาคม ในการสื่อสารไร้สาย เสาอากาศมักได้รับการออกแบบให้ส่งและรับสัญญาณด้วยการวางแนวโพลาไรเซชันเฉพาะ เพื่อปรับปรุงคุณภาพสัญญาณและลดการรบกวน ระบบการสื่อสารผ่านดาวเทียม วิทยุกระจายเสียง และระบบเรดาร์ยังใช้เทคนิคโพลาไรเซชันเชิงเส้นเพื่อเพิ่มประสิทธิภาพการรับและส่งสัญญาณ
สมการเชิงเส้นถูกนำมาใช้ในการแก้ปัญหาที่เกี่ยวข้องกับสิ่งไม่รู้สองตัวอย่างไร
สมการเชิงเส้นมักใช้เพื่อแก้ปัญหาที่เกี่ยวข้องกับสิ่งไม่รู้สองตัว ด้วยการแทนปัญหาด้วยสมการเชิงเส้นสองสมการ คุณสามารถกำหนดค่าของตัวแปรที่ไม่รู้จักได้โดยการค้นหาจุดตัดกัน วิธีนี้เรียกว่าวิธีการแทนที่หรือกำจัด ซึ่งช่วยให้สามารถแก้ไขปัญหาต่างๆ ในโลกแห่งความเป็นจริงได้ เช่น การคำนวณอายุ ความสัมพันธ์ระหว่างระยะทาง-ความเร็ว-เวลา และปัญหาส่วนผสม
การประมาณค่าเชิงเส้นทำงานอย่างไรในการวิเคราะห์ข้อมูล
การประมาณค่าเชิงเส้นเป็นวิธีที่ใช้ในการวิเคราะห์ข้อมูลเพื่อประมาณค่าระหว่างจุดข้อมูลที่ทราบ โดยถือว่าความสัมพันธ์เชิงเส้นระหว่างจุดต่างๆ และใช้เส้นตรงเพื่อประมาณค่าที่หายไป ด้วยการคำนวณความชันและจุดตัดระหว่างจุดข้อมูลที่ติดกัน คุณสามารถประมาณค่าภายในช่วงของชุดข้อมูลที่กำหนดได้
แอปพลิเคชั่นเชิงเส้นในโลกแห่งความเป็นจริงมีอะไรบ้าง?
การเขียนโปรแกรมเชิงเส้นมีการใช้งานจริงมากมาย ใช้ในการจัดการห่วงโซ่อุปทานเพื่อเพิ่มประสิทธิภาพการผลิตและการจัดจำหน่าย ช่วยในการจัดสรรทรัพยากรและการจัดตารางกำลังคนสำหรับธุรกิจ การเขียนโปรแกรมเชิงเส้นยังพบการประยุกต์ใช้ในการเพิ่มประสิทธิภาพพอร์ตโฟลิโอ การวางแผนการขนส่ง การวางแผนอาหาร และแม้แต่ทฤษฎีเกม
Linear Feedback Shift Registers (LFSRs) ในการเข้ารหัสคืออะไร
ในวิทยาการเข้ารหัสลับ LFSR ถูกใช้เพื่อสร้างตัวเลขหรือลำดับการสุ่มเทียม ขึ้นอยู่กับพีชคณิตเชิงเส้นและใช้ฟีดแบ็คลูปเพื่อเปลี่ยนบิตของรีจิสเตอร์ในลักษณะที่คาดเดาได้แต่ดูเหมือนสุ่ม LFSR มีบทบาทสำคัญในการเข้ารหัสสตรีมและอัลกอริธึมการเข้ารหัสอื่นๆ
มุมมองเชิงเส้นทำงานอย่างไรในงานศิลปะ?
ในงานศิลปะ มุมมองเชิงเส้นเป็นเทคนิคที่สร้างความลึกและความสมจริงในภาพวาดหรือภาพวาดสองมิติ มันเกี่ยวข้องกับการใช้เส้นมาบรรจบกันและจุดที่หายไปเพื่อสร้างภาพลวงตาของระยะทางและพื้นที่ โดยการปฏิบัติตามหลักการของเปอร์สเปคทีฟเชิงเส้น ศิลปินสามารถถ่ายทอดฉากสามมิติบนพื้นผิวเรียบได้อย่างแม่นยำ
สามารถใช้โปรแกรมเชิงเส้นกับระบบเรียลไทม์ได้หรือไม่?
ได้ การโปรแกรมเชิงเส้นสามารถนำไปใช้กับระบบเรียลไทม์ได้ แม้ว่าจะขึ้นอยู่กับข้อกำหนดและข้อจำกัดเฉพาะของระบบก็ตาม ในบางกรณี สามารถใช้เทคนิคการเขียนโปรแกรมเชิงเส้นเพื่อเพิ่มประสิทธิภาพการจัดสรรทรัพยากรแบบเรียลไทม์ การจัดกำหนดการ และกระบวนการตัดสินใจได้ อย่างไรก็ตาม การพิจารณาความซับซ้อนในการคำนวณและข้อจำกัดด้านเวลาของระบบเป็นสิ่งสำคัญเมื่อใช้การเขียนโปรแกรมเชิงเส้นในสถานการณ์แบบเรียลไทม์
การเขียนโปรแกรมเชิงเส้นมีส่วนช่วยในการเพิ่มประสิทธิภาพการไหลของเครือข่ายอย่างไร
การเขียนโปรแกรมเชิงเส้นมีบทบาทสำคัญในปัญหาการเพิ่มประสิทธิภาพการไหลของเครือข่าย ด้วยการสร้างแบบจำลองเครือข่ายเป็นกราฟที่มีโหนดและขอบที่แสดงถึงเอนทิตีและการเชื่อมต่อ คุณสามารถใช้เทคนิคการเขียนโปรแกรมเชิงเส้นเพื่อกำหนดเส้นทางการไหลที่เหมาะสมที่สุด สิ่งนี้มีประโยชน์อย่างยิ่งในด้านต่างๆ เช่น ลอจิสติกส์การขนส่ง เครือข่ายโทรคมนาคม และการจัดการห่วงโซ่อุปทาน ซึ่งการไหลเวียนของทรัพยากรอย่างมีประสิทธิภาพเป็นสิ่งสำคัญ